125 /*
126 * Each process has:
127 *
128 * - An array of open file descriptors (fd_ofiles)
129 * - An array of file flags (fd_ofileflags)
130 * - A bitmap recording which descriptors are in use (fd_map)
131 *
132 * A process starts out with NDFILE descriptors. The value of NDFILE has
133 * been selected based the historical limit of 20 open files, and an
134 * assumption that the majority of processes, especially short-lived
135 * processes like shells, will never need more.
136 *
137 * If this initial allocation is exhausted, a larger descriptor table and
138 * map are allocated dynamically, and the pointers in the process's struct
139 * filedesc are updated to point to those. This is repeated every time
140 * the process runs out of file descriptors (provided it hasn't hit its
141 * resource limit).
142 *
143 * Since threads may hold references to individual descriptor table
144 * entries, the tables are never freed. Instead, they are placed on a
145 * linked list and freed only when the struct filedesc is released.
146 */

809 /*
810 * Check for a race with close.
811 *
812 * The vnode is now advisory locked (or unlocked, but this case
813 * is not really important) as the caller requested.
814 * We had to drop the filedesc lock, so we need to recheck if
815 * the descriptor is still valid, because if it was closed
816 * in the meantime we need to remove advisory lock from the
817 * vnode - close on any descriptor leading to an advisory
818 * locked vnode, removes that lock.
819 * We will return 0 on purpose in that case, as the result of
820 * successful advisory lock might have been externally visible
821 * already. This is fine - effectively we pretend to the caller
822 * that the closing thread was a bit slower and that the
823 * advisory lock succeeded before the close.
824 */

2061 /*
2062 * Free the old file table when not shared by other threads or processes.
2063 * The old file table is considered to be shared when either are true:
2064 * - The process has more than one thread.
2065 * - The file descriptor table has been shared via fdshare().
2066 *
2067 * When shared, the old file table will be placed on a freelist
2068 * which will be processed when the struct filedesc is released.
2069 *
2070 * Note that if onfiles == NDFILE, we're dealing with the original
2071 * static allocation contained within (struct filedesc0 *)fdp,
2072 * which must not be freed.
2073 */

2904 /*
2905 * POSIX record locking dictates that any close releases ALL
2906 * locks owned by this process. This is handled by setting
2907 * a flag in the unlock to free ONLY locks obeying POSIX
2908 * semantics, and not to free BSD-style file locks.
2909 * If the descriptor was in a message, POSIX-style locks
2910 * aren't passed with the descriptor, and the thread pointer
2911 * will be NULL. Callers should be careful only to pass a
2912 * NULL thread pointer when there really is no owning
2913 * context that might have locks, or the locks will be
2914 * leaked.
2915 */

5582 /*
5583 * File Descriptor pseudo-device driver (/dev/fd/).
5584 *
5585 * Opening minor device N dup()s the file (if any) connected to file
5586 * descriptor N belonging to the calling process. Note that this driver
5587 * consists of only the ``open()'' routine, because all subsequent
5588 * references to this file will be direct to the other driver.
5589 *
5590 * XXX: we could give this one a cloning event handler if necessary.
5591 */
